How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Studio City?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Studio City Studio Apartments with Utilities Included | $1,991 | $850 | $3,995 |
Studio City 1 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,462 | $1,257 | $7,423 |
Studio City 2 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$3,106 | $1,900 | $8,807 |
Studio City 3 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$4,028 | $2,979 | $8,500 |
Studio City 4 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$4,814 | $1,160 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Utilities Included Studio City Apartments
What is the Cheapest Utilities Included apartment in Studio City?
Currently the most affordable Utilities Included Apartment in Studio City is at 6205 Fulton Ave listed at $1,450.
How much is the average rent for a Utilities Included Studio City Apartment?
The average rent for a Utilities Included Apartment in Studio City is $2,175.
What is the largest Utilities Included Studio City Apartment for rent?
Today's Utilities Included apartment with the most square footage in Studio City is a 1,500 square feet unit starting from $3,595 at 6120 Woodman Ave.
What is the average size for Studio City Utilities Included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Utilities Included rental in Studio City is currently at 722 sq ft.
